27Class
28 Foam::Function1Types::halfCosineRamp
29
30Description
31 Half-cosine ramp function starting from 0 and increasing to 1 from \c start
32 over the \c duration and remaining at 1 thereafter.
33
34See also
35 Foam::Function1Types::ramp
